Why is Subsea Cable Storage Monitoring Crucial? Subsea cables are the backbone of global communication, transmitting over 99% of international data traffic. During storage, they are coiled in large tanks and exposed to various environmental and physical stresses. Monitoring ensures early detection of potential damage, preventing costly repairs and service outages that can amount to millions of dollars per incident and disrupt critical data flow. It preserves the significant capital investment in these assets, which can range from tens of millions to hundreds of millions of dollars per cable system.

Why are subsea cables so vulnerable during storage? During storage, subsea cables are often spooled onto large drums. This process introduces significant bending and torsional stresses that can lead to micro-fractures in optical fibers or fatigue in metallic conductors, even before deployment. Static pressure and ambient temperature fluctuations in storage facilities, while less extreme than in the ocean, can also contribute to material degradation over extended periods, making continuous monitoring crucial to detect early signs of damage and prevent future failures during active service.

Advanced Material Selection for Harsh Environments The longevity and reliability of subsea electronics hinge on superior material selection. Our PCBs are manufactured using high-grade, marine-grade laminates and conformal coatings specifically chosen for their resistance to saltwater corrosion, extreme pressure, and wide temperature variations. Key materials include high-Tg (glass transition temperature) FR-4 or specialized polyimide substrates for enhanced thermal stability, and robust encapsulants that protect sensitive components from ingress. This meticulous material engineering extends component lifespan and prevents premature failure, guaranteeing sustained performance in the most unforgiving subsea conditions. We also incorporate lead-free, high-reliability solders and use components rated for extended temperature ranges, further enhancing the system's resilience. The selection process involves rigorous testing against industry standards for subsea applications, ensuring that every PCB component contributes to the overall durability and operational integrity of the monitoring solution.

Optimized PCB Design for Subsea Environments Our design process for subsea PCBs is meticulously crafted to address the unique challenges of underwater operation. This includes careful selection of substrate materials with excellent dielectric properties and low moisture absorption, strategic impedance matching for high-frequency signal integrity over long distances, and robust power plane design to minimize noise and ensure stable power delivery to sensitive sensors. We prioritize miniaturization and efficient layout to fit within compact subsea enclosures while maximizing performance and reliability. Advanced thermal management techniques are also employed to dissipate heat effectively, preventing component degradation in confined, often unventilated, subsea modules.
Precision Manufacturing and Quality Control At Zero One Solution, our manufacturing processes for subsea PCBs adhere to the highest industry standards, including IPC Class 3 for mission-critical applications. We utilize automated assembly lines for unparalleled precision in component placement and soldering, minimizing human error. Our rigorous quality control protocols include Automated Optical Inspection (AOI), X-ray inspection for hidden solder joints, and In-Circuit Testing (ICT) to verify electrical functionality of every board. Furthermore, environmental stress screening (ESS) through thermal cycling and vibration testing simulates real-world subsea conditions, ensuring that our PCBs maintain their integrity and performance under extreme pressure, temperature fluctuations, and corrosive environments. Every PCB undergoes comprehensive functional testing before deployment to guarantee its readiness for subsea operations.
